Tips for Creating a Spa Bathroom at Home

  • Introduce Calming Colors
    Go for soft colors like whites, greens, or blues. These shades can give your bathroom that relaxing vibe you’re aiming for.
  • Use Scented Candles or Essential Oils
    It’s amazing what a pleasant scent can do. Eucalyptus or lavender oils are perfect for bringing a sense of calm and freshness.
  • Install a Rainfall Showerhead
    This small upgrade can make showers feel more luxurious. The gentle rain-like flow can elevate your everyday routine.
  • Incorporate Natural Elements
    Add some potted plants or wooden accents. These details add a touch of nature and warmth to your bathroom space.

Luxurious Spa Bathroom Retreat

Imagine sinking into a deep soaking tub, surrounded by calming candlelight and soft music. That’s what a luxurious spa bathroom retreat feels like! Think marble finishes, plush towels, and gold accents.

Try using warm, neutral colors with a few lavish elements like a chandelier or designer faucets to create the perfect escape. Why not add a plush bath mat or a large potted plant?

These small touches can transform any bathroom into your personal oasis. The idea is to make your spa bathroom feel like a five-star hotel suite. Consider installing a rainfall showerhead or even a steam shower for that ultimate luxury experience.

Minimalist Home Spa Bathroom Decor

Less is definitely more. The minimalist style is all about simplicity, clean lines, and subtle elegance. Opt for a neutral color palette with whites, beiges, or soft grays.

Consider open shelving to display a few well-chosen bathroom decor pieces like a beautiful candle or a small plant. Uncluttered countertops are a must, so look for smart storage solutions to keep things tidy.

Stick to one or two high-quality pieces instead of many decorations. How about a streamlined bathtub or a sleek vanity? Natural materials such as wood or stone add warmth without overwhelming the space.

When done right, a minimalist home spa feels effortlessly chic and refreshingly calming.

Nature-Inspired Spa Bathroom Oasis

Want to bring the outdoors in? A nature-inspired spa bathroom can make that dream come true. Use natural materials like wood, stone, and bamboo. These can add a fresh, relaxing vibe to your space.

Earthy tones, along with green plants or even a small vertical garden, can help create that serene oasis. Bamboo bathmats or wooden stools can introduce texture without stealing the show.

Natural light makes a great impact, so keep window treatments simple or opt for frosted glass for privacy. Consider a river rock shower floor or a pebble-filled basin for an authentic touch.

Modern Home Spa Bathroom Elegance

Step into sleek sophistication with a modern spa bathroom design that stays ahead of the curve. Think geometric shapes, clean lines, and a monochromatic color scheme.

Black or navy accents paired with white tiles can offer a striking contrast that’s still soothing. Try adding tech-savvy touches like LED lighting or a smart mirror to mix function with style.

High-gloss finishes on cabinets and fixtures add a contemporary edge, while metallic accents bring a touch of glamour. Why not consider a floating vanity or a walk-in shower with glass doors?

These choices can amplify the modern aesthetics of your spa bathroom. It’s all about finding that balance between cutting-edge design and everyday comfort.

Calming Zen Spa Bathroom Decor

Need a space to totally unwind? A Zen-inspired spa bathroom is all about creating a tranquil, balanced environment. Minimalism is key, with a focus on natural elements like wood and water.

Soft, neutral colors such as whites and beiges dominate, creating a calm palette. Rocks, pebbles, or a small fountain can add an element of nature and serenity.

Minimalistic bathroom decor such as a single orchid or a bonsai tree can provide the natural Zen atmosphere. Warm, soft lighting and scented candles can add warmth and tranquility to your space.

This style is designed to offer peace and relaxation, a place where your worries seem to simply float away.
